FCC Consumer Complaints – 27 October 2024
Introduction
On Sunday, 27 October 2024, 500 consumer complaints relating to telecommunications services were recorded in the Federal Communications Commission system, this represented a decline from the 675 complaints recorded the day before. The complaints came from 42 states and territories, with California reporting a modestly higher count than the other locations. Complaints relating to Unwanted Calls were marginally higher than for other issue types.

What the complaints were about
A total of 5 complaint categories were represented in the complaints recorded on this date. Phone was the most reported category, with 357 complaints. Complaint activity was strongly concentrated in this category, with other categories contributing comparatively fewer reports.
| Complaint category | Complaints |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Phone | 357 | 71.4% |
| Internet | 99 | 19.8% |
| TV | 32 | 6.4% |
| Radio | 7 | 1.4% |
| Emergency | 5 | 1.0% |
